Twin Protagonists: Shinobi or Samurai?
For the first time within the collection, players Handle two protagonists with contrasting playstyles:
Naoe the Shinobi – A stealthy assassin who takes advantage of grappling hooks, throwing shuriken, and smoke bombs to do away with targets. Her gameplay is reminiscent of classic Assassin’s Creed titles, emphasizing parkour and silent kills.
Yasuke the Samurai – Inspired by the true-lifetime historical determine, Yasuke can be a weighty-hitting warrior who depends on katana duels, parries, and Uncooked strength. His battle feels weighty, delivering brutal ending moves.
Gamers can switch among the two figures, enabling them to strategy missions with stealth or direct fight. This dynamic retains gameplay contemporary, providing multiple ways to deal with targets.
Refined Beat and Stealth Mechanics
Shadows improves upon previous AC online games with smoother parkour, far more specific swordplay, and Increased enemy AI. Beat is more tactical, necessitating nicely-timed dodges and parries. Duels against rival samurai come to feel rigorous, comparable to Ghost of Tsushima’s standoffs.
Stealth mechanics have also been refined, with new hiding tactics, assassination animations, and environmental interactions making sneaky techniques extra worthwhile. Even so, some AI inconsistencies and minimal bugs still persist.
